- Asterisk is a complete PBX in software. It provides all of the features you would expect from a PBX and more. Asterisk does voice over IP in three protocols and can interoperate with almost all standards-based telephony equipment using relatively inexpensive hardware. Asterisk provides voicemail services with directory, call conferencing, interactive voice response, and call queuing. It has support for three-way calling, caller ID services, ADSI, SIP, and H.323 (as both client and gateway).
